我将来自weatherunderground的.json信息拉入Flash CC。解析数据后,我留下以下变量:
我正试图找到“条件”变量。但我无法到达那里因为整数/数字“0”我如何格式化它?
这是我的代码:
function completeHandler(event: Event): void
{
var loader1: URLLoader = URLLoader(event.target);
var data1: Object = JSON.parse(loader1.data);
trace(data1.forecast.simpleforecast.forecastday.0.conditions);
}
这适用于路径中没有整数的变量。
答案 0 :(得分:1)
forecastday
是一个数组,您可以在“值”列([] (@...
)中看到该数组。 JSON只是告诉你数组中每个元素包含的内容,所以只需使用data1.forecast.simpleforecast.forecastday[0].conditions
,或者每天循环播放。